掌握PHP网络编程,实战项目轻松上手

发布时间:2025-05-23 00:30:20

引言

PHP作为一种广泛利用于Web开辟的剧本言语,凭仗其易学性、高效性跟富强的社区支撑,成为众多开辟者爱好的抉择。控制PHP收集编程,实战项目是测验进修成果的最好方法。本文将具体介绍怎样经由过程实战项目轻松上手PHP收集编程。

一、PHP基本知识

1. PHP情况搭建

在开端实战项目之前,须要搭建PHP开辟情况。以下是在Windows情况下搭建PHP情况的步调:

  1. 安装XAMPP或WAMP等集成开辟情况(IDE),它们供给了Apache、MySQL跟PHP等软件的安装包。
  2. 启动Apache跟MySQL效劳。
  3. 在浏览器中拜访http://localhost/,检查能否成功安装了PHP。

2. PHP基本语法

PHP语法类似于C言语,易于进修。以下是一些基本语法:

  • 变量:$variableName = value;
  • 数据范例:intfloatstringbool等。
  • 流程把持:ifelseswitchforwhile等。
  • 函数:function functionName() { ... }

二、实战项目入门

1. 简单的登录注册体系

这是一个非常合适初学者的项目,经由过程实现登录跟注册功能,可能懂得PHP与数据库的交互。

  • 利用MySQL数据库存储用户信息。
  • 利用PHP编写登录跟注册表单处理代码。
  • 利用md5加密用户密码。
  • 利用session管理用户登录状况。

2. 简单的博客体系

博客体系是一个功能较为复杂的实战项目,可能锤炼编程才能跟数据库操纵技能。

  • 利用MySQL数据库存储文章信息。
  • 利用PHP编写文章发布、编辑、删除等操纵。
  • 利用分页技巧实现文章列表展示。
  • 利用标签跟分类功能。

三、高等实战项目

1. 购物车体系

购物车体系是一个涉及多个模块的实战项目,可能懂得PHP的面向东西编程(OOP)。

  • 利用MySQL数据库存储商品信息、订单信息等。
  • 利用PHP编写商品展示、增加购物车、结算等操纵。
  • 利用OOP计划商品、订单、购物车等类。
  • 利用session或cookie管理购物车。

2. 交际收集体系

交际收集体系是一个功能复杂、技巧请求较高的实战项目,可能懂得PHP的缓存、异步处理等技巧。

  • 利用MySQL数据库存储用户信息、好友关联、静态等。
  • 利用PHP编写用户注册、登录、宣布静态、批评、私信等操纵。
  • 利用缓存技巧进步体系机能。
  • 利用异步处理技巧实现及时更新。

四、总结

经由过程以上实战项目,可能逐步控制PHP收集编程的技能。在进修过程中,要留神以下多少点:

  1. 多练习,多动手。
  2. 懂得并控制PHP语法跟OOP。
  3. 学会利用MySQL数据库。
  4. 懂得罕见的Web开辟技巧,如HTML、CSS、JavaScript等。

祝你在PHP收集编程的道路上越走越远!